The Comprehensive Guide to Car Key Replacement: Types, Costs, and Processes

In an age where technology has reinvented nearly every element of our lives, car key replacement is no exception. With the advancement of key innovation-- from standard metal keys to advanced smart keys-- comprehending the choices available for replacing car keys is vital for vehicle owners. This post looks into the different types of car keys, their particular replacement procedures, expenses, and often asked questions that car owners might come across.

Types of Car Keys

Comprehending the different types of car keys is important for determining the most appropriate replacement options. Here are the primary categories of car keys:

Comprehending Each Key Type

  1. Traditional Keys

    • These are one of the most fundamental keys utilized in older cars. They are typically made from metal and function no electronic components. Replacement is frequently simple and typically requires a locksmith or dealer.
  2. Transponder Keys

    • Transponder keys come geared up with a chip that sends an unique signal to the vehicle's ignition system. If the key isn't acknowledged, the vehicle will not begin. Changing a transponder key usually involves not only cutting a brand-new key but also setting the chip, which can increase both the intricacy and expense of replacement.
  3. Smart Keys

    • Smart keys utilize innovative technology allowing for keyless entry and ignition. Instead of inserting a key, chauffeurs should have the smart key within proximity to begin their vehicle. Changing wise keys can be pricey due to the technology included.
  4. Remote Key Fobs

    • These devices enable remote locks and other functions like panic buttons or trunk release. Replacement often includes the requirement to synchronize the fob with the vehicle's system, which can be done through a dealership or a locksmith professional.
  5. Valet Keys

    • Created for short-lived usage, these keys usually supply access to only vital functions. The replacement process is akin to traditional keys, as they do not contain any innovative components.

The Car Key Replacement Process

The procedure for replacing a car key can vary depending upon the key type and the car design. Here's a basic summary of the steps involved:

Step-by-Step Key Replacement Process

  1. Identify the Key Type:

    • Determine whether the key is a standard, transponder, clever key, or remote fob.
  2. Collect Necessary Information:

    • Have your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) and proof of ownership ready to help with the replacement process.
  3. Choose a Replacement Method:

    • Dealership: The most dependable technique, however often the most pricey. Best for smart keys and complex transponder keys.
    • Locksmith professional: A more inexpensive choice if dealing with standard or some transponder keys. Look for professionals in automotive keys.
    • Online Services: Websites exist that deal key cutting and shows services; however, caution is advised with prospective security risks.
  4. Program the Key:

    • If suitable, programs needs to be carried out to sync the brand-new key with the vehicle's systems. This can need specific devices typically available at a dealership or automotive locksmith professional.
  5. Test the Key:

    • After replacement, test the brand-new key's performance to guarantee it operates all car functions, including ignition and remote functions.

Costs of Car Key Replacement

The expenses of car key replacements can differ widely based upon numerous elements, such as key type, vehicle make and design, and the replacement approach. Below is a breakdown of typical costs related to numerous key types.

Key TypeEstimated Cost Range
Conventional Keys₤ 2 - ₤ 10
Transponder Keys₤ 50 - ₤ 250
Smart Keys₤ 200 - ₤ 600
Remote Key Fobs₤ 50 - ₤ 300
Valet Keys₤ 5 - ₤ 20

Extra Factors Affecting Cost

  • Intricacy of Programming: The more complex the key innovation, the greater the programs fee.
  • Place: Prices may differ by area due to varying labor rates and cost of living.
  • Emergency Services: Expect to pay more for immediate or emergency locksmith professional services, particularly outside routine organization hours.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. How long does it take to replace a car key?

The time taken varies based on the kind of key and the replacement method. For traditional keys, it may take simply a few minutes. For sophisticated wise keys, it can take longer due to programs.

2. What if I've lost my car keys entirely?

If you've lost all your keys, you may require to contact a dealership for a complete key reprogramming and replacement given that they can create a brand-new key based on your VIN.

3. Can I still drive my car without a key?

No, you can not. If you've lost your key, you'll require to replace it before you can start the vehicle again.

4. Is it possible to configure a new key myself?

While it's possible for some easier keys, the majority of modern keys-- specifically transponder and smart keys-- need specialized devices and abilities for appropriate shows.
